Serena Williams issues her response to Drake-related comments after Super Bowl performance

News RoomBy News RoomFebruary 18, 2025No Comments2 Mins Read
Facebook Twitter Telegram Copy Link Pinterest LinkedIn Tumblr Email WhatsApp

The fallout from the Super Bowl continues, both on and off of the field. This time, it is Serena Williams who is making headlines after she responded to the comments from pundits about Drake.

The tennis legend was part of Kendrick Lamar‘s halftime show at Super Bowl LIX, as she could be seen crip walking amongst the many other dancers on the field at the Caesars Superdome when Kendrick performed ‘Not like Us’.

Many people suggested that she took part in the event purely to get back at her ex, Drake, who the song is about.

“If I’m married and my wife is going to join trolling her ex, go back to his a-,” Stephen A. Smith said earlier last week on First Take. “‘Cause clearly you don’t belong with me. What you worried about him for and you’re with me? Bye. Bye.”

Howard Stern chose to take the same opinion as Smith, saying: “He’s got a point. I hear what he’s saying,” Stern said on The Howard Stern Show Tuesday (Feb. 11) .

“She used to go out with Drake, and by dissing him at the Super Bowl, it indicates she’s still living that whole scenario. He’s right. I agree with Stephen A.”

Serena Williams responds

Williams issued an expectedly classy response to the men talking about her.

“That there my baby daddy and husband. Always got my back. I Love you,” she wrote on Xabout Alex Ohanian, her husband who has been defending her online. “Gosh I’m so late to the game (I’ve been sick) & busy investing in billion dollar companies and running @WYNbeauty… def not dancing to be petty lol.”

She continued: “I think I proved 23 times over (not counting 4 gold medals) that I simply don’t have time for petty. All love and respect always nothing negative here.”
